For many of us, Congressman John Lewis has served as a powerful inspiration, and the July 17 protest marks the anniversary of his passing (Rest In Power!). John Lewis famously coined the term “Good Trouble,” and while John is no longer with us, his actions and his words still move us. Saline Indivisible is excited to celebrate his legacy and is now excited to share our planning updates.

While protesting on the “four corners,” we have coordinated with local shops to host fun activities for families and crafty individuals. Our goal is to make “Good Fun” and introduce the late congressmen and “Good Trouble” to the next generation.
